| Aspect | Guest Communications | Front Desk Agent |
|---|
| Primary Role | Handling guest inquiries, providing information, and managing communication channels | Checking in/out guests, managing reservations, and providing customer service at the front desk |
| Required Skills | Excellent communication, problem-solving, and customer service skills | Customer service, organization, and basic administrative skills |
| Work Environment | Office or reception area, often behind the scenes or remotely | Front desk, hotel lobby, face-to-face guest interaction |
| Common Certifications | Hospitality or communication certifications (optional) | Hospitality or front desk training (optional) |
Guest Communications focuses on managing guest interactions through various channels, emphasizing communication skills. In contrast, Front Desk Agents handle direct guest check-ins, reservations, and face-to-face service. While both roles require strong customer service abilities, Guest Communications often involves behind-the-scenes or remote communication, whereas Front Desk Agents are the frontline representatives of the establishment.
